The Decentralized Clinical Trials (DCT) market is on a significant growth trajectory, as projected by MarketDigits. Valued at USD 8.5 Billion in 2023, the market is expected to reach USD 13.3 Billion by 2030, exhibiting a robust CAGR of 6.6% during the forecast period from 2023 to 2030. DCTs leverage digital health technologies such as mobile apps, wearables, and telemedicine to conduct trials remotely, reducing participant burden and expanding geographical reach. This trend aims to diversify participant demographics, making trials more accessible and inclusive.
Moreover, the USFDA has also undertaken initiatives to provide enhanced guidance to organizations regarding the collection of remote data through digital health technologies. This is articulated in the final guidance document titled "Digital Health Technologies for Remote Data Acquisition in Clinical Investigations." Decentralized clinical trials, therefore, will see continued growth this year.

AI and ML are revolutionizing clinical trials by streamlining study participation and enhancing data analysis. AI is employed to link patients to suitable clinical trials, while ML algorithms analyze vast datasets for patient selection, reducing recruitment delays. Additionally, AI plays a pivotal role in predictive modeling, enabling real-time adaptation of trial strategies based on emerging data trends in clinical trials.

Patient-centric approaches will continue into 2024, with added emphasis and focus. Patient feedback on study design, easily understandable consent processes, flexible scheduling, and the incorporation of patient-reported outcomes (PROs) as primary endpoints are becoming integral to trial designs, enhancing relevance and applicability of results.

In December 2023, the USFDA published a guidance document on the “Real-World Data: Assessing Registries To Support Regulatory Decision-Making for Drug and Biological Products” According to this document, USFDA has established a framework for the Real-World Evidence (RWE) Program with the aim of assessing the viability of utilizing RWE in endorsing a new indication for a drug already sanctioned under section 505(c) of the FD&C Act. Alternatively, it serves to assist in fulfilling post-approval study requirements. Within the framework of this initiative, the provided guidance outlines factors for sponsors who intend to create a new registry or leverage an existing one to contribute to regulatory decision-making regarding a drug's safety or effectiveness. This approach is bridging the gap between current trends in pharmacology and clinical trials and real-world scenarios.

Recognizing the importance of diverse trial populations, regulatory bodies, particularly the FDA, are actively working towards increasing clinical trial diversity. Initiatives aimed at participation from underrepresented racial and ethnic populations align with broader healthcare equity goals.
Ensuring diversity in clinical trials is not just a necessity; it's a crucial step towards comprehensive healthcare solutions. Minorities, especially in underserved areas, often lack proper medical care, and the key to addressing this issue lies in their inclusion in clinical trials. In 2022, personalized medicines accounted for 34% of all new FDA drug approvals, as reported by the Personalized Medicine Coalition, reflecting a robust industry focus on treatments tailored to individual genetic profiles. Such new trends in clinical trials necessitate more biomarker-driven clinical trials, which tend to be more targeted and often yield more potent therapeutic benefits.

The FDA and European Medicines Agency (EMA) are increasingly focusing on data integrity, patient safety, and ethical considerations in trials. Pharmaceutical companies may have increased regulatory pressure. Good Clinical Practice (GCP) guidelines reflect a more rigorous regulatory environment in response to advanced trial methodologies.
